Leticia, a city on the Colombian side of the Amazon border, has been the focus of recent tensions due to territorial disputes with Peru. President Gustavo Petro arrived in Leticia over two hours late for a commemoration event of the Battle of Boyacá, where his ministers stated that they would reaffirm Colombia's sovereignty over the Amazon region. Meanwhile, Mayor of Medellín Daniel Quintero has warned Peru that he would not hesitate to go to war if they persist in their claims over Leticia. Eduardo Arana, Peru's Prime Minister, is set to visit Santa Rosa de Loreto, with Petro attending a ceremony in Leticia, potentially escalating the situation. The visit by Arana coincides with Petro's presence in Leticia, raising concerns about the potential for further conflict. RPP, a Peruvian news outlet, has arrived in Leticia following the controversy sparked by Petro's statements. Locals in Leticia have rejected Petro's stance, expressing their desire to maintain the current harmonious relationship with Peru. Laura Sarabia, a key figure in Colombia's government, resigned as Foreign Minister amidst multiple scandals and disagreements with the administration. Her departure sparked concerns about potential diplomatic crises and calls for her to reveal sensitive information.

Álvaro Leyva, former Colombian Foreign Minister, is accused of plotting to remove President Gustavo Petro from office, with alleged support from the U.S. and criticism from various political figures. Petro and his allies have publicly denounced these accusations, while Leyva has not yet responded.
